What Is Crypto Arbitrage Trading?
Crypto arbitrage trading is a sophisticated strategy used by traders to take advantage of price discrepancies between different cryptocurrency exchanges. These price differences occur because various exchanges operate independently and may list the same cryptocurrency at slightly different rates due to factors like liquidity, demand, and regional variations. For example, if Bitcoin is priced at $30,000 on one exchange (Exchange A) and $30,100 on another (Exchange B), a trader can buy Bitcoin from Exchange A and sell it on Exchange B, earning the $100 difference. This process is automated and often relies on sophisticated algorithms to identify and execute such opportunities swiftly.
The primary goal of crypto arbitrage is to generate profits by capitalizing on these temporary price gaps. Traders need to act fast because these differences can disappear quickly as other market participants catch on to the opportunity. Additionally, successful arbitrage trading requires not only identifying price discrepancies but also considering transaction fees, exchange withdrawal times, and potential risks associated with volatility.
Arbitrage opportunities can arise in various forms, such as inter-exchange, cross-border, or even within the same exchange through different trading pairs. While the concept may sound straightforward, it requires careful risk management and a deep understanding of market dynamics. Moreover, the crypto market is highly volatile, and these opportunities may vary based on market conditions, making it essential for traders to stay informed and responsive to changes.

Types of Crypto Arbitrage
Type of Crypto Arbitrage | Description | Example | Pros | Cons |
Spatial Arbitrage | Involves trading cryptocurrencies between two different exchanges where price differences are present. | Buying Bitcoin on Exchange A at $30,000 and selling on Exchange B at $30,100. | Simple to execute, fast profits. | Limited by exchange liquidity and fees. |
Triangular Arbitrage | Utilizes price discrepancies between three trading pairs on the same exchange. | Trading BTC/USD, BTC/ETH, and ETH/USD, identifying price inefficiencies among them. | Efficient in using multiple pairs for profit. | Complexity in execution and potential slippage. |
Statistical Arbitrage | Relies on statistical models and algorithms to detect price inefficiencies and patterns over time. | Analyzing historical price data to predict future price movements and capture discrepancies. | Accurate long-term opportunities, reducing human error. | Requires advanced technical skills and data analysis. |

Gather APIs and Documentation
To build a successful crypto arbitrage bot, it is essential to gather APIs and documentation from the exchanges you plan to work with. Most exchanges provide APIs that allow bots to interact with their platforms for real-time data and trade execution.
First, visit the exchanges’ websites to create accounts and register for API keys. Some exchanges require account verification before generating API keys for security purposes. This step ensures that your bot has the necessary permissions to access market data and execute trades.
Once you have the API keys, download the API documentation from the exchange’s platform. This documentation provides details about endpoints, available methods, and authentication processes. Understanding the API documentation is crucial for effectively integrating the APIs into your bot.
Lastly, make sure to familiarize yourself with the specific features and limitations of each exchange’s API. Different exchanges may offer varying levels of functionality, including withdrawal limits, real-time data streaming, and order types. This ensures that your bot can handle all necessary tasks efficiently while staying within the exchange’s rules and limitations.
Plan Your Bot’s Architecture
Bot Component | Description | Functions | Tools/Technologies | Benefits | Challenges |
Data Collection Module | Responsible for retrieving real-time price data from exchanges. | Fetches prices and updates them regularly. | APIs, Web Scraping | Provides accurate, up-to-date data. | May face rate-limiting issues from exchanges. |
Analysis Module | Identifies arbitrage opportunities using price discrepancies. | Analyzes price differences and selects profitable opportunities. | Machine Learning, Statistical Models | Helps make data-driven decisions. | Requires constant monitoring of market trends. |
Execution Module | Automatically places trades based on identified opportunities. | Executes buy/sell orders without manual intervention. | API Calls, Automated Scripts | Ensures timely and consistent trade execution. | Risks of slippage or failed transactions. |
Logging Module | Maintains a record of all transactions and errors. | Tracks historical trades and system errors. | Database, Logging Tools | Provides a detailed audit trail for transparency. | May require extensive storage depending on activity level. |
Test Your Bot
Before deploying your crypto arbitrage bot into a live environment, it is crucial to thoroughly test its functionality. This helps identify and fix any issues before real money is at risk.
- Backtesting: This involves using historical data to simulate trades. By running the bot with past market conditions, you can evaluate its performance and profitability. Backtesting helps ensure that your bot works as intended without risking real funds. Additionally, it allows you to refine strategies based on historical performance.
- Sandbox Accounts: Many exchanges provide sandbox or test environments where you can integrate your bot’s API without making actual trades. These test accounts mirror real trading accounts but do not use real funds. This allows for seamless testing of features like order execution, price fetching, and error handling in a risk-free setting.

Challenges to Expect
When building and running a crypto arbitrage bot, there are several challenges that traders need to be prepared for. One major challenge is fees, as trading on multiple exchanges incurs transaction costs. These fees, whether for buying or selling, can reduce overall profits, especially when dealing with small price differences. Therefore, it’s important to carefully account for these costs when designing a bot’s strategy.
Another significant challenge is latency. Network delays and slow API responses can lead to missed arbitrage opportunities. Since price differences can change rapidly, even a slight delay in executing trades can result in lost profits. Ensuring fast, reliable connections and low-latency environments is crucial to maintaining a competitive edge.
Slippage is yet another challenge, where the price changes between the time an order is placed and when it is executed. This can lead to trades being completed at less favorable prices than originally intended, impacting the profitability of the bot. Managing slippage requires implementing risk management strategies and setting realistic expectations.
Overall, while crypto arbitrage bots offer significant potential, understanding and addressing these challenges is essential for ensuring smooth and profitable trading operations.
